Re: TP Software Issues/Unresolved Issues/Feature Requests

Not sure if this is a feature already implemented or in the process of being implemented, but it would be awesome if there were a program to automatically adjust orientation of the screen according to the g-sensor at all times. From the reviews and my experience with the Diamond I hear that the gsensor is only active when viewing pictures and on Opera. It would be cool to also extend this feature across the entire OS.
